Transaction 43ae8fb1104c1dd5be5e924a1629ae93ba653cacb6a811a3d9ed6fb588fd8043
1 Input
2 Outputs
- 43ae8fb1104c1dd5be5e924a1629ae93ba653cacb6a811a3d9ed6fb588fd8043:0
- 43ae8fb1104c1dd5be5e924a1629ae93ba653cacb6a811a3d9ed6fb588fd8043:1
value 100000
address 3DPKXQ1nq7AUt6tU4ibAPqC7aPz7TGjrSK
value 13478276
address 18kWncH4WpM6fy1Bh43Fk7d1K3T6FHnbvo